2001 Jeep Wrangler Fuel regulator?
my Jeep is a 2001, 2.5 FI. everywhere I look on teh internet shows the fuel rail that goes to the injectors as the fuel regulator, since its built into the rail, I've been around for 46 years and I know for a fact that a fuel regulator should have a return line hooked up to it somewhere, alas theres only one line hooked up anywhere on this thing, and thats teh line coming from the tank supplying fuel to the rail.
Anybody out there know what this thing really is?

Re: 2001 Jeep Wrangler Fuel regulator?
That because it's also the filter located on top of the fuel pump.

Re: 2001 Jeep Wrangler Fuel regulator?
Here's what I found on it, it looks to me like it's just a spring loaded diaphragm to help keep the fuel pressure steady and keep the pump pulsations to a minimum. The testing section makes no mention of testing the damper only that the fuel pressure should be 49.2 Psi +/- 5 Psi.

Re: 2001 Jeep Wrangler Fuel regulator?
That's each at NAPA, the holes don't wear larger if any the plunger gets sticky or the holes become smaller or clogged with varnish and carbon.
